The Duchess of Sussex, also known as Meghan Markle, announced that her Netflix show ‘With Love, Meghan’ is returning for Season 2 on the streaming service.

Meghan, 43, shared news of the renewal on social media in sn Instagram video that included the various sounds of cooking — slicing vegetables, heating butter on the stove, cracking eggs and more, with the caption: “Oh, how I love ASMR! If you’re loving Season 1, just wait until you see the fun we cooked up on Season 2! Thanks for joining the party, and an endless thanks to the amazing team and crew who helped bring it all to life!”

“With Love, Meghan” features Meghan sharing her tips about cooking, hosting, crafting, decorating and more, alongside famous friends joining her in the kitchen and garden –those friends this season included actor/writer Mindy Kaling, famed restaurateur Alice Waters, celebrity chef Roy Choi, makeup artist Daniel Martin and Meghan’s former “Suits” co-star Abigail Spencer.

Shortly after Season 1 of With Love, Meghan debuted on March 4, Netflix announced that sophomore season has already been filmed and will air on the streamer sometime in the fall; a specific date has not yet been shared. The streamer said on its official website:  “Meghan, Duchess of Sussex will be back with more tips and tricks this fall.”

Season 1 of “With Love, Meghan” is available to stream now on Netflix.
